State Laughter is written by Evgeny Dobrenko and published by Oxford University Press. It's available with International Standard Book Number or ISBN identification 0198840411 (ISBN 10) and 9780198840411 (ISBN 13).
Stalin's reign of terror was not all doom and gloom, much of it was (meant to be) funny! Tracing the development of official humour, satire, and comedy, Dobrenko and Jonsson-Skradol do away with the idea that all humour in the USSR was subversive, instead exploring why laughter was a core component to the survival of the Soviet regime.
